Under Order class understands Medal Kundler (Phaleristiker) the gradation of an order or in the broadest sense, a distinction. The purpose is to achieve a difference in the level of appreciation through the grading. For this purpose, the order decorations are made of different materials, but at least different in size and put on in different ways and worn by the order member or the honoree.

In many religious foundations, membership of a class was dependent on the nobility or only possible at all. Many perks, especially financial ones, were dependent on the religious class. The founder often made himself grandmaster .

The bearers in the religious classes were often limited to a certain number. Each class has its own name. Orders are not always awarded in all classes, or the order has been structured in this way (deviating for example the Iron Cross ). A difference between the classes was also possible in terms of clothing (order mantle).

Often the classes were simply numbered, for example: " Red Eagle Order  IV Class".

There are also distinctions between

  • Peace class
  • Military class

(for example at Pour le Mérite ).
